Title
ROUND-LEAVED SUNDEW DROSERA ROTUNDIFOLIA IN THE ZALEŚNIAK FOREST DISTRICT
Autor
Elżbieta Pastwik, Maciej Skorupski
Keywords
unused meadows, Drosera rotundifolia, Zaleśniak, transitional bog
Abstract
The aim of the study was an inventory of round-leaved sundew Drosera rotundifolia in Zaleśniak Forest District (Lutówko Forest Inspectory, Regional Directorate of State Forest in Toruń), determination of the size of the population of sundew and identification of groups of characteristic species growing with sundew. On a map of the Zaleśniak Forest District from the Military Institute of Geography from 1935 six objects were described as a meadow. The meadow was abandoned, resulting in its transformation. Now they are included in the network Natura 2000 as transitional bogs. The inventory of round-leaved sundew was made in the Zaleśniak Forest District in 2010. Five transitional bogs with the sundew were found and placed on a map. Also there was one with previously inventoried sundew, but it was not observed during this research.
